Compartir a través de


DocumentBase.FollowHyperlink (Método)

Resuelve un hipervínculo o muestra un documento en memoria caché si el documento ya se ha descargado.

Espacio de nombres:  Microsoft.Office.Tools.Word
Ensamblado:  Microsoft.Office.Tools.Word.v4.0.Utilities (en Microsoft.Office.Tools.Word.v4.0.Utilities.dll)

Sintaxis

'Declaración
Public Sub FollowHyperlink ( _
    ByRef address As Object, _
    ByRef subAddress As Object, _
    ByRef newWindow As Object, _
    ByRef addHistory As Object, _
    ByRef extraInfo As Object, _
    ByRef method As Object, _
    ByRef headerInfo As Object _
)
public void FollowHyperlink(
    ref Object address,
    ref Object subAddress,
    ref Object newWindow,
    ref Object addHistory,
    ref Object extraInfo,
    ref Object method,
    ref Object headerInfo
)

Parámetros

  • address
    Tipo: System.Object%
    Dirección del documento de destino.
  • subAddress
    Tipo: System.Object%
    Ubicación en el documento de destino.El valor predeterminado es una cadena vacía.
  • newWindow
    Tipo: System.Object%
    true para mostrar la ubicación de destino en una nueva ventana.El valor predeterminado es false.
  • addHistory
    Tipo: System.Object%
    true para agregar el vínculo a la carpeta de historial del día actual.
  • extraInfo
    Tipo: System.Object%
    Cadena o matriz de bytes que especifica información adicional que utiliza HTTP para resolver el hipervínculo.Por ejemplo, puede utilizar ExtraInfo para especificar las coordenadas de un mapa de imágenes, el contenido de un formulario o un nombre de archivo FAT.La cadena se envía o se anexa, dependiendo del valor de Method.Utilice la propiedad ExtraInfoRequired para determinar si se requiere información adicional.
  • headerInfo
    Tipo: System.Object%
    Cadena que especifica información de encabezado para la solicitud HTTP.El valor predeterminado es una cadena vacía.En Visual Basic, puede combinar varias líneas de encabezado en una sola cadena utilizando la siguiente sintaxis: "cadena1 " & vbCr & "cadena2 ".La cadena especificada se convierte automáticamente en caracteres ANSI.Observe que el argumento HeaderInfo podría sobrescribir los campos de encabezado HTTP predeterminados.

Comentarios

Este método muestra el documento en memoria caché situado en el parámetro Address, si ya se había descargado. De lo contrario, este método resuelve el hipervínculo, descarga el documento de destino y muestra el documento en la aplicación correspondiente. Si el hipervínculo utiliza el protocolo de archivos, este método abre el documento en lugar de descargarlo.

Parámetros opcionales

Para obtener información sobre parámetros opcionales, vea Parámetros opcionales en las soluciones de Office.

Ejemplos

En el ejemplo de código siguiente se utiliza el método FollowHyperlink para mostrar una página Web en una nueva ventana. Para usar este ejemplo, ejecútelo desde la clase ThisDocument en un proyecto de nivel de documento.

Private Sub DocumentFollowHyperlink()
    Me.FollowHyperlink(Address:="http://www.adatum.com", _
        NewWindow:=True, AddHistory:=False)
End Sub
private void DocumentFollowHyperlink()
{
    object address = "http://www.adatum.com/";
    object newWindow = true;
    object addHistory = false;

    this.FollowHyperlink(ref address, ref missing, ref newWindow,
        ref addHistory, ref missing, ref missing, ref missing);
}

Seguridad de .NET Framework

Vea también

Referencia

DocumentBase Clase

Microsoft.Office.Tools.Word (Espacio de nombres)